Career and Affiliations

Stéphane Collin worked as a researcher[3]. Employers include Centre de nanosciences et de nanotechnologies[4], a research institute[14], in France[15], founded in 1998[16]; Swiss Federal Institute of Technology in Lausanne[5], a public university[17], in Switzerland[18], founded in 1969[19]; Ile-de-France Photovoltaic Institute[6], a research institute[20], in France[21], headquartered in Palaiseau[22]; Laboratoire de Photonique et de Nanostructures[7], an Unité Propre de Recherche[23], in France[24], founded in 1998[25]; and University of Tokyo[8], a research university[26], in Japan[27], founded in 1877[28], headquartered in Hongō campus[29]. He supervised Romaric de Lépinau as a doctoral student[12].
